Obstetrical Ultrasound

The Ultrasound Unit at NYU Langone Medical Center is a world-class diagnostic referral center. We are here to help identify potential obstetrical, medical or fetal problems at an early enough point in the pregnancy to maximize the likelihood of a healthy child. Our unit is staffed by highly-trained sonographers, as well as maternal-fetal medicine specialists (perinatologists), who provide coverage.

Using state-of-the-art 2 and 3 dimensional ultrasound equipment, complete with computer networking and automated report faxing, we are able to provide comprehensive obstetrical ultrasound services. The ultrasound unit is accredited by the Accreditation Commission of the American Institute of Ultrasound in Medicine to perform the ultrasound exams, as well as by the Fetal Medicine Foundation to perform early fetal comprehensive testing (nuchal translucency and biochemical testing).

Obstetrical Ultrasound

  • Non-invasive, comprehensive first trimester evaluation for risk of aneuploidies and other anomalies (nuchal translucency and blood testing)
  • Genetic ultrasound
  • 11-14 weeks early fetal anomaly scans using high-frequency 2D and 3D transducers
  • Early second and third trimester fetal structural evaluation
  • 2D/3D evaluation of the fetal brain (fetal neuroscan)
  • First and early second trimester evaluation of multifetal pregnancies
  • Evaluation of the cervix in pregnancy
  • 3D evaluation of fetal anomalies (special brochure available)
  • Biophysical profile
  • Doppler evaluation of fetal well being (umbilical artery, ductus venosus, middle cerebral artery, etc.)

Ultrasound Guided Obstetrical Procedures

  • Amniocentesis of singleton and multifetal pregnancies*
  • Chorionic villus sampling (CVS) of singleton and multifetal pregnancies (transcervical as well as transabdominal)
  • Multifetal pregnancy reduction (special brochure available)
  • Guidance for obstetrical procedures: PUBS, amnio-reduction, cord occlusion in twins, etc.
  • Fetal muscle or liver biopsies
  • Fetal shunt placements

Counseling Services

  • Genetic counseling by certified genetic counselors for patients whose fetuses have chromosomal anomalies and anatomic malformations and for multifetal pregnancy reduction
  • Second opinion for sonographically detected obstetrical anomalies
  • Maternal-Fetal Medicine (Perinatology) consultations
